What is a Waist Size Using Height and Weight Calculator?
A Waist Size Using Height and Weight Calculator is an online tool designed to provide an estimated waist circumference based on an individual’s height and weight. While direct measurement is always the most accurate method for determining waist size, this calculator offers a convenient way to get a preliminary estimate and understand how these fundamental body metrics relate. It often incorporates other health indicators like Body Mass Index (BMI) and Waist-to-Height Ratio (WHtR) to give a more comprehensive picture of body composition and potential health risks.

Common Misconceptions About Waist Size Using Height and Weight Calculators
- It provides exact measurements: This calculator offers an *estimation*. Actual waist size is influenced by muscle mass, fat distribution, bone structure, and genetics, which are not fully captured by height and weight alone.
- It replaces professional medical advice: The results are for informational purposes only and should not be used to diagnose or treat any health condition. Always consult a healthcare professional for personalized advice.
- It’s a perfect indicator of health: While waist size is a significant health indicator, it’s just one piece of the puzzle. Overall health involves many factors, including diet, exercise, genetics, and lifestyle.
- It works universally for all body types: The underlying formulas are based on general population trends and may not perfectly reflect individuals with very high muscle mass (e.g., bodybuilders) or specific medical conditions.
Waist Size Using Height and Weight Calculator Formula and Mathematical Explanation
Our Waist Size Using Height and Weight Calculator employs a simplified, illustrative model to estimate waist circumference. It first calculates your Body Mass Index (BMI) and then uses this, along with your height, to derive an estimated waist size. This approach acknowledges the strong correlation between overall body mass (reflected by BMI) and central adiposity (waist circumference).
Step-by-Step Derivation:
- Unit Conversion: All inputs are converted to metric units (height in meters, weight in kilograms) for consistency in calculations.
- Body Mass Index (BMI) Calculation:
BMI = Weight (kg) / (Height (m))^2BMI is a simple index of weight-for-height that is commonly used to classify underweight, overweight, and obesity in adults.
- Estimated Waist Circumference Calculation:
Our calculator uses an illustrative formula that combines height and BMI to estimate waist size. A common health guideline suggests that waist circumference should ideally be less than half of one’s height. Our formula aims to reflect this general principle while adjusting for overall body mass:
Estimated Waist (cm) = (Height (cm) * 0.48) + (BMI - 22) * 1.5This formula assumes a baseline waist circumference that is slightly less than half of the height for an average BMI (around 22). It then adjusts this baseline upwards for higher BMIs and downwards for lower BMIs. The coefficients (0.48 and 1.5) are illustrative and chosen to yield plausible results within typical adult ranges.
- Waist-to-Height Ratio (WHtR) Calculation:
WHtR = Estimated Waist (cm) / Height (cm)WHtR is considered a good indicator of central obesity and associated health risks, often preferred over BMI for this purpose.

Practical Examples of Using the Waist Size Using Height and Weight Calculator
Let’s look at a couple of real-world scenarios to understand how the Waist Size Using Height and Weight Calculator works and what the results might indicate.
Example 1: An Average Adult Male
John is 180 cm (5 feet 11 inches) tall and weighs 85 kg (187 lbs).
- Inputs: Height = 180 cm, Weight = 85 kg
- Calculations:
- Height in meters = 1.80 m
- BMI = 85 kg / (1.80 m)^2 = 85 / 3.24 = 26.23 kg/m²
- Estimated Waist (cm) = (180 * 0.48) + (26.23 – 22) * 1.5 = 86.4 + 4.23 * 1.5 = 86.4 + 6.345 = 92.745 cm
- WHtR = 92.745 cm / 180 cm = 0.515
- Outputs:
- Estimated Waist Size: Approximately 92.7 cm (36.5 inches)
- BMI: 26.23 (Overweight)
- WHtR: 0.515 (Increased Risk)
- Waist Category: Increased Risk
- Interpretation: John’s BMI indicates he is in the overweight category. His estimated waist size and WHtR suggest an increased risk for health issues associated with central obesity. This would prompt him to consider lifestyle changes and consult a doctor.
Example 2: An Average Adult Female
Sarah is 165 cm (5 feet 5 inches) tall and weighs 60 kg (132 lbs).
- Inputs: Height = 165 cm, Weight = 60 kg
- Calculations:
- Height in meters = 1.65 m
- BMI = 60 kg / (1.65 m)^2 = 60 / 2.7225 = 22.04 kg/m²
- Estimated Waist (cm) = (165 * 0.48) + (22.04 – 22) * 1.5 = 79.2 + 0.04 * 1.5 = 79.2 + 0.06 = 79.26 cm
- WHtR = 79.26 cm / 165 cm = 0.480
- Outputs:
- Estimated Waist Size: Approximately 79.3 cm (31.2 inches)
- BMI: 22.04 (Healthy Weight)
- WHtR: 0.480 (Healthy)
- Waist Category: Healthy
- Interpretation: Sarah’s BMI falls within the healthy weight range, and her estimated waist size and WHtR are also in the healthy category. This suggests a lower risk for obesity-related health problems based on these metrics.

Key Factors That Affect Waist Size Using Height and Weight Results
While our Waist Size Using Height and Weight Calculator provides a useful estimation, it’s important to understand the various factors that influence actual waist size and how they might differ from a calculated value. These factors highlight why direct measurement is always recommended for accuracy.
- Body Composition: The ratio of muscle to fat significantly impacts waist size. Two individuals with the same height and weight can have vastly different waist measurements if one has more muscle mass (which is denser) and the other has more body fat. The calculator cannot differentiate between muscle and fat.
- Fat Distribution: Genetics play a huge role in where your body stores fat. Some people are “apple-shaped” (store more fat around the abdomen), while others are “pear-shaped” (store more fat around hips and thighs). This calculator provides a general estimate and doesn’t account for individual fat distribution patterns.
- Age: As people age, muscle mass tends to decrease, and fat distribution can shift, often leading to increased abdominal fat even if overall weight remains stable. The calculator’s formula is a general model and doesn’t specifically adjust for age-related changes.
- Gender: Men and women typically have different body compositions and fat distribution patterns. While our calculator uses a general formula, actual waist sizes can vary significantly between genders for the same height and weight due to hormonal differences.
- Ethnicity: Research shows that different ethnic groups can have varying body compositions and health risk thresholds for BMI and waist circumference. The calculator uses a generalized formula that may not perfectly apply to all ethnic backgrounds.
- Physical Activity Level: Regular exercise, especially strength training, builds muscle and can reduce abdominal fat, leading to a smaller waist circumference. A sedentary lifestyle can have the opposite effect. The calculator only considers static height and weight.
- Diet and Nutrition: A diet high in processed foods and sugars can contribute to increased visceral fat (fat around organs), which directly impacts waist size. A healthy, balanced diet can help maintain a healthy waist.
- Hormonal Factors: Hormonal imbalances (e.g., related to thyroid, cortisol, or reproductive hormones) can influence weight gain and fat distribution, affecting waist circumference.
- Medical Conditions: Certain medical conditions (e.g., PCOS, Cushing’s syndrome) and medications can lead to weight gain and increased abdominal fat, impacting waist size independently of height and weight.
- Posture: Poor posture can temporarily affect the appearance of waist size, making it seem larger than it is.
Understanding these factors helps in interpreting the results from any Waist Size Using Height and Weight Calculator and emphasizes the importance of a holistic view of health.

A: Waist circumference is a key indicator of abdominal obesity, which is the accumulation of fat around the internal organs. High abdominal fat is strongly linked to an increased risk of type 2 diabetes, heart disease, stroke, and certain cancers, even in individuals with a healthy BMI.
A: General guidelines suggest that for most adults, a healthy waist circumference is less than 94 cm (37 inches) for men and less than 80 cm (31.5 inches) for women. However, the Waist-to-Height Ratio (WHtR) is often considered a more robust indicator, with a WHtR below 0.5 generally considered healthy.
A: No, this Waist Size Using Height and Weight Calculator is designed for adult use only. Body composition and growth patterns in children are different, and pregnancy significantly alters body measurements. Consult a pediatrician or obstetrician for appropriate health assessments in these cases.
A: BMI (Body Mass Index) assesses overall weight relative to height. WHtR (Waist-to-Height Ratio) specifically measures central obesity, which is fat around the abdomen. WHtR is often considered a better predictor of health risks associated with fat distribution than BMI alone.

A: To measure manually, stand upright and place a tape measure around your bare abdomen, just above your hip bones. Ensure the tape is snug but not compressing your skin, and parallel to the floor. Breathe out normally and take the measurement.
A: Yes, significantly. Muscle is denser than fat. An individual with high muscle mass might have a higher weight and BMI, which could lead to a higher estimated waist size from the calculator, even if their actual waist circumference is relatively small due to low body fat. This is a limitation of any calculator relying solely on height and weight.
